Today, for up to four travelers, FCF’s research team has discovered an opportunity to save up to 70,000 miles, each way when compared to normal/everyday prices traveling to/from the U.S.
Sample Savings: Houston and Washington, DC to/from Frankfurt’s and Boston to/from Munich’s normal/everyday price can often be 170,000 miles each way when using United miles but if you use Amex and Chase Points partner Air Canada miles the cost can be as low as 100,000 miles each way.
